11 methods to fix Android GPS not working
- Turn off and on GPS again.
- Turn on and turn off Airplane mode.
- Update the phone.
- Disable Power Saver.
- Enable Google Location Accuracy.
- Enter Safe Mode and check whether the GPS works fine.
- Get the latest Google Maps.
- Clear cache from the map app.

Why is my GPS not working on my Android?
Location issues are often caused by a weak GPS signal. If you can’t see the sky, you’ll have a weak GPS signal and your position on the map might not be correct. Navigate to Settings > Location > and make sure Location is ON. Navigate to Settings > Loction > Sources Mode and tap High Accuracy.

How do I reset my GPS on my Samsung?
Android GPS Toolbox After downloading, launch the GPS Status & Toolbox app. Click the menu button, then click on “Tools.” Click on the “Manage A-GPS State” option, and then the “Reset” button to clear your GPS cache.

How do I update my GPS on Huawei health?
For Android users: Open the Huawei Health app, touch Devices, touch the device name, then enable Auto-download update packages over Wi-Fi. If there are any new updates, the watch will display update reminders. Follow the onscreen instructions to update your watch.
Why is my GPS not working on my Samsung phone?
There are several reasons why a phone’s or tablet’s GPS signal may not work properly, such as a communication failure with the satellite. Other times, it could be because your Location is disabled or because you are not using the best Location method.
